Output e96dbdcb5daa1ef6c2683ad27d33767377bb5607b7e918facb0a33c212c15024:2

value
621700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 30ae7b79c2ee587aba58762155774ee5a0109df7 OP_EQUAL
address
368RNzjVWzVJxuhuhky53iqggzixtbCwYG
transaction
e96dbdcb5daa1ef6c2683ad27d33767377bb5607b7e918facb0a33c212c15024
spent
true